How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Elryia Swansea?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Elryia Swansea Studio Apartments | $1,742 | $756 | $4,719 |
| Elryia Swansea 1 Bedroom Apartments | $2,003 | $810 | $6,924 |
| Elryia Swansea 2 Bedroom Apartments | $2,830 | $972 | $10,000+ |
| Elryia Swansea 3 Bedroom Apartments | $3,604 | $966 | $10,000+ |
| Elryia Swansea 4 Bedroom Apartments | $2,727 | $1,253 | $3,338 |
